About 3 Clarence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Clarence Street is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Wath-Upon-Dearne, Rotherham, Rotherham (S63 6RE). It has a recorded floor area of 66 m² (around 710 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2025)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in November 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a basement.

Untraded for 19 years, with the last transfer in June 2007.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Across 1999–2007, sale prices on this property compounded at 18.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£110,000 sits 50.7% above the 2007 sale of £73,000.
